Personal Experience & Biography
My name is Julia, and I am in the process of completing a Master of Arts in Counselling Psychology. I specialize in working with individuals and couples, focusing on areas such as anxiety (including generalized anxiety disorder, panic disorder, and health anxiety), depression, intimacy/sex, ob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), and relationship challenges.
I draw on a blend of modalities tailored to meet the unique needs of my clients. These include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), Solution-Focused Therapy, and the Gottman Method for relationship counselling. My approach is compassionate and client-focused, prioritizing the creation of a safe and supportive environment for growth and healing.
I know that starting therapy can feel intimidating, and it’s not always easy to open up about deeply personal struggles. Whether you’re navigating anxiety, depression, rebuilding trust in your relationships, or seeking greater self-understanding, I am here to support you on your journey. Growth and healing are not linear processes, but with the right tools and guidance, they are achievable.

Credentials
I am currently completing a Master’s degree in Counselling Psychology. In addition to my graduate studies, I hold a Bachelor’s degree in Criminology with a Minor in Psychology. I am also a Level 1 Gottman Method Therapist.
